ENTREES Mac and Cheese Casserole Cups This fun twist on the classic macaroni and cheese casserole is not just delicious, but it’s also a lot of fun to make! PREP TIME: 20 MINUTES COOK TIME: 15 MINUTES YIELDS: 10 SERVINGS INGREDIENTS Cheesy Chicken Crunchers These kid-friendly baked chicken fingers have extra protein from the cheese that’s added to the crispy cereal coating. PREP TIME: 30 MINUTES COOK TIME: 25 MINUTES YIELDS: 6 SERVINGS INGREDIENTS 1 cup all-purpose flour 1/8 teaspoon salt 1/8 teaspoon pepper 4 egg whites 1/2 cup milk 1 1/2 cups cornflakes cereal 1 cup shredded Cheddar cheese 6 chicken breast fillets, cut into strips Nonstick cooking spray 3 cups milk 2 1/2 tablespoons all-purpose flour 1 1/2 cups shredded Cheddar cheese 3/4 cup shredded mozzarella cheese 1/2 cup grated Parmesan cheese 8 ounces elbow macaroni, cooked and drained 1. Preheat oven to 350°. In medium saucepan, add 1 cup of milk to flour, stirring constantly until lumps have dissolved. Add remaining milk, stirring thoroughly. Place on stove and simmer 15 minutes, stirring occasionally, until sauce thickens. 2. Add 1 cup of Cheddar, mozzarella and Parmesan cheese; stir until blended. Add macaroni, stirring gently to coat well. 3. Line muffin tin with paper muffin cups and place one scoop of mac and cheese mixture into each muffin cup. Top with remaining cheese and bake 15 minutes or until golden brown. 1. Preheat oven to 375˚ and set up three bowls with the following: flour mixed with a pinch of salt and pepper; an egg-wash made by beating the eggs and milk together; and cornflakes mixed with cheese. 2. Coat a 13– x 9–inch baking pan with nonstick cooking spray. Dip chicken in flour, then into egg-wash, then roll in cereal mixture, coating entire piece of chicken and place on baking pan. 3. Discard any unused cereal mixture after coating chicken. Bake 25 minutes, turning halfway through to ensure even browning. 9 10
